We are seeking a Transport Architect to join our multi award-winning client in London. If you possess design flair, creative problem-solving and have a proven track record on large-scale transport projects, this may be the job for you.

Required Skills and Experience:

  • At least 3 years of experience in the transport sector
  • Excellent all-rounded skills with experience working on projects from start to completion
  • Strong design background
  • Competency with Revit
  • Flexibility and willingness to work on international projects

Benefits:

  • Join an award-winning studio of 35 people in central London
  • Hybrid working
  • Professional subscriptions + memberships
  • Comprehensive private medical insurance with BUPA
